[LU-10016] Downgrading Lustre 2.10.1 ZFS to 2.9.0 ZFS gives a pool cannot be found error on import Created: 21/Sep/17  Updated: 25/Sep/17  Resolved: 25/Sep/17

Status: Closed
Project: Lustre
Component/s: None
Affects Version/s: Lustre 2.10.1
Fix Version/s: None

Type: Bug Priority: Critical
Reporter: James Casper Assignee: Nathaniel Clark
Resolution: Cannot Reproduce Votes: 0
Labels: zfs
Environment:

trevis


Issue Links:
Related
is related to LU-9960 Rolling downgrade master to 2.10 - un... Resolved
Severity: 3
Rank (Obsolete): 9223372036854775807

 Description   

May be related to LU-9960. It fixed the "can't import into ZFS 6.5.7 because a 7.1 feature is installed" issue.

Two downgrade tests:
Downgrade 2.10.1 to 2.10.0: zfs 7.1 to zfs 6.5.9 - works
Downgrade 2.10.1 to 2.9.0: zfs 7.1 to zfs 6.5.7 - pool not found

Pool not found is seen with zpool import <pool name> and zpool import <pool GUID>.



 Comments   
Comment by Peter Jones [ 21/Sep/17 ]

Nathaniel

Could you please advise?

Thanks

Peter

Comment by Andreas Dilger [ 21/Sep/17 ]

James, do you have more information about the errors printed when this problem happens?

Comment by James Casper [ 21/Sep/17 ]
[root@trevis-62 ~]# zpool import -f 11022747677743727868
cannot import '11022747677743727868': no such pool available
Comment by Nathaniel Clark [ 22/Sep/17 ]

Can you show a bare zfs import from trevis-62 (via ZFS 0.6.5.7)?

I assume this is Lustre 2.10.1-RC1 (so with the LU-9960 patch).

Comment by James Casper [ 22/Sep/17 ]

I'm running another upgrade/downgrade test now (EE3 --> 2.10.1 --> EE3). EE3 also uses 6.5.7 ZFS, so if I don't see this issue there, I'll retest 2.9.0 --> 2.10.1 --> 2.9.0.

Comment by James Casper [ 22/Sep/17 ]

Downgrade from 2.10.1 to EE3 passed. Retesting 2.10.1 to 2.9.0. Will close on Monday if that passes.

Comment by James Casper [ 25/Sep/17 ]

Also passed in a 2.10.1 to 2.9.0 retest. Most likely user error. Closing.

Generated at Sat Feb 10 02:31:18 UTC 2024 using Jira 9.4.14#940014-sha1:734e6822bbf0d45eff9af51f82432957f73aa32c.